Chapter 1

I'm at an auction with my mother-in-law, Agnes Bachert. She spots a breathtaking emerald necklace, and we end up winning it for 30 million dollars.

The auctioneer signals for payment. To make things easier, Agnes suggests charging it to my father-in-law Otto Garrett's account.

But just as she says this, a flashy middle-aged woman and a young woman storm over. The younger woman, Janette Saccone, grabs Agnes' arm while the middle-aged woman, Ruth Coleman, slaps her hard.

"I knew something was off!" Ruth snarls. "You're a nasty old bitch for destroying my family and trying to seduce my husband! I hope you suffer!"

I rush to shield Agnes. "Are you okay?"

Ruth's sharp gaze snaps onto me when she hears me speak. "Your mother-in-law has no shame, throwing herself at rich men. And you're not even embarrassed for her?"

I step in front of Agnes and tell Ruth that I'm married into the Garrett family, then demand to know who she is.

Ruth gives me a cold, arrogant look. "Who am I? I'm Otto Garrett's legal wife—the one he married officially!"

She gives me a look of pure contempt. "And who are you to question me?"

Before I can say a single word, she pulls out her phone and dials a number. "Clement, my dear son, get to the auction house right now! Help me catch this homewrecker!"

Clement Garrett? That's my husband. Since when does he have another mother?

After hanging up, the woman who called herself Ruth Coleman shot us a taunting smirk. Then she shoved my mother-in-law, Agnes Bachert, straight onto the auction stage.

I tried to run after them, but a young woman, Janette Saccone, stepped in and cut me off. She clenched her teeth and demanded, "Who do you think you are?"

I could tell that she was spoiling for a fight, and I instinctively stepped back. But that only gave her the chance she needed. She darted forward and grabbed my arm. "Listen! I'm engaged to Clemmie. He's mine."

Meanwhile, on stage, Ruth grabbed the auctioneer's microphone. Her shrill voice cut through the hall. "Everyone, remember this face. It's the face of a damn slut!"

As she spoke, she kept smacking Agnes' cheek with the back of her hand. "Tell me, how does it feel to cheat with my husband?

"You've got some nerve, dropping his name in public like that! Did you really think that you could get away with it?"

Agnes' face was ghostly pale. Desperate, I wrenched free from Janette and got onto the stage, shielding Agnes behind me.

"Agnes, are you okay?" I asked.

She shook her head faintly. "Ronnie… how could this happen? How… How could I be the other woman?"

Her breathing quickened, and her hands trembled. I couldn't waste a single second. I grabbed her heart medication from my bag and slipped it into her mouth.

"Agnes, there has to be some kind of misunderstanding!"

Otto Garrett, my father-in-law, and Agnes had been childhood sweethearts. Their marriage was strong, their love steady. They treated each other with the utmost respect and had never once raised their voices.

"A misunderstanding?"

Ruth had heard every single word. Her face twisted with rage. "You're still playing dumb after I caught you red-handed!"

I tried to calm Agnes while forcing myself to stay composed. "You say you're Mr. Garrett's wife. Do you have any proof?"

I lifted Agnes' right hand. A massive pink diamond sparkled brilliantly under the light. "Everyone here knows this ring, don't they?

"Mr. Garrett handcrafted it for his wife. It's the only one in the world! That should be enough to prove who we are."

Agnes, the youngest in her family and a premature baby, had been pampered her whole life. Because of her heart condition, she couldn't handle a big wedding, and she didn't like being around strangers. So when she and Otto married, only a few close friends were invited to the ceremony.

Everyone knew that Otto had a beloved wife, but no one had ever seen her face.

Just when I thought that the situation was over, Ruth suddenly went wild and yanked the ring off Agnes' finger.

She snapped, "This is a token between Otto and me. Where did you get it?"

Her face twisted with anger. After a moment, a smug realization flickered across her expression. "So it turns out you're not just the other woman. You're a thief too!"

She slipped the ring onto her own ring finger and held her hand up so everyone could see it. "I lost this ring a while ago. I thought I'd never find it again.

"Who would have thought…"

She trailed off, letting the sentence hang in the air. Everyone in the room immediately turned on us, pointing and sneering.

"The real wife's here, and you're still pretending!"

"Look at her trembling. Anyone can see that she's faking it."

I frowned and reached for my phone to call the police. However, Janette snatched it from my hand, a smirk spreading across her face. "What, calling for backup now?"

Ruth shoved me to the ground, sending Agnes tumbling down beside me. She looked down at us. "Do you have any more proof to back up your story?"

When we stayed quiet, her grin grew wider. "No? I thought so. Because I do."

Then, under everyone's puzzled stares, she unhurriedly pulled out a sleek black-and-gold card.

"This is my husband Otto's exclusive credit card. I think this proves who I am."

"No way! That card has to be fake!"
